阿尔茨海默病与高血压研究的前沿与热点演变:2004年至2023年的文献计量分析

Frontiers and hotspot evolution in research on Alzheimer's disease and hypertension: a bibliometric analysis from 2004 to 2023.

Abstract

BACKGROUND

Alzheimer's disease (AD) is a neurodegenerative disease that imposes a heavy burden on patients and their families. Hypertension is an important risk factor for AD, but the specific mechanism of its impact is still unclear. This study thus aimed to analyze the relationship and trend changes between AD and hypertension through bibliometric methods.

METHODS

Literature on AD and hypertension was retrieved from the Web of Science Core Collection (WoSCC) database between 2004 and 2023. Data regarding countries, institutions, authors and journals were sourced from WoSCC. CiteSpace and VOSviewer were used for data visualization, including author collaboration, timelines view of references, reference bursts and overlay visualization maps of keywords. Excel 2018 software was used for the statistical analysis.

RESULTS

A total of 1,833 publications were ultimately included. From 2004 to 2023, the number of publications per year basically showed an increasing trend. The United States (United States) not only had the largest output of publications and the highest H-index but also had the seven highest frequencies of publication institutions. Kehoe, Patrick ranked first with the most articles among 9,330 authors. The journal with the most published articles was the Journal of Alzheimer's Disease. Reference analysis revealed a hotspot in the exploration of the pathophysiological association between AD and hypertension. Second, the treatment effects and potential risks of antihypertensive drugs (AHDs) on AD are also the focus of research. Researchers have carried out a series of studies ranging from basic research to clinical research on AHDs for the treatment of AD. Finally, personalized treatment strategies will also become one of the hotspots of future research. Controlling hypertension through lifestyle changes and medication interventions in AD patients is a promising strategy. The analysis of keywords revealed that "amyloid deposition," "preeclampsia," "Corona Virus Disease 2019 (COVID-19)" and "biomarkers" have been research hotspots in recent years.

CONCLUSION

By analyzing the references and keywords, we summarized the hot topics and research trends in this field. These findings provide useful information for researchers to explore the relationship between hypertension and AD further, with the hope of providing more effective treatments for AD patients to delay disease progression and improve quality of life.

摘要

背景

阿尔茨海默病(AD)是一种给患者及其家庭带来沉重负担的神经退行性疾病。高血压是AD的一个重要风险因素,但其具体影响机制仍不清楚。因此,本研究旨在通过文献计量学方法分析AD与高血压之间的关系及趋势变化。

方法

从2004年至2023年的科学网核心合集(WoSCC)数据库中检索关于AD和高血压的文献。有关国家、机构、作者和期刊的数据均来自WoSCC。使用CiteSpace和VOSviewer进行数据可视化,包括作者合作、参考文献的时间线视图、参考文献爆发以及关键词叠加可视化地图。使用Excel 2018软件进行统计分析。

结果

最终共纳入1833篇出版物。2004年至2023年,每年的出版物数量基本呈上升趋势。美国不仅出版物产出量最大、H指数最高,而且有7个出版物机构的发文频率最高。在9330位作者中,基奥·帕特里克发表的文章数量最多,排名第一。发表文章最多的期刊是《阿尔茨海默病杂志》。参考文献分析揭示了AD与高血压之间病理生理关联探索的一个热点。其次,抗高血压药物(AHDs)对AD的治疗效果和潜在风险也是研究重点。研究人员针对AHDs治疗AD开展了一系列从基础研究到临床研究的工作。最后,个性化治疗策略也将成为未来研究的热点之一。通过生活方式改变和药物干预控制AD患者的高血压是一种有前景的策略。关键词分析表明,“淀粉样蛋白沉积”“先兆子痫”“2019冠状病毒病(COVID-19)”和“生物标志物”是近年来的研究热点。

结论

通过分析参考文献和关键词,我们总结了该领域的热点话题和研究趋势。这些发现为研究人员进一步探索高血压与AD之间的关系提供了有用信息,有望为AD患者提供更有效的治疗方法,以延缓疾病进展并提高生活质量。
